The birth of Debra Abston

Debra S Abston was born on February 12, 1960 in Solano County, California.

Her father's last name is Abston, and her mother's maiden name is Thomas. If Debra is still alive, she's now years old.

Her potential siblings include Timothy (born 1962).

Name Debra S Abston
Sex female
Birthdate 02/12/1960
Birthplace Solano County, California
Mother's Maiden Name Thomas
Contact